I see two regressions in upcoming Plasma 5.2.1 of which I am not sure
where to address them (plasma-workspace or kwin).
First, the Alt-F2 key combo to start krunner stopped working. In a
kosnole I see a weird character being typed if I press Alt-F2. The
systemsettings5 actually detects my Alt-F2 correctly when I try to
force those keys as the Global Shortcut for krunner, but it still does
not make a difference.
Second: when I start a program like vncviewer through krunner, it no
longer gets keyboard focus on its text entry field, and the same
happens with the password dialog of vncviewer. I have to click with
my mouse into the text entry field (just examples, did not test or
need more programs).
Reverting to Plasma 5.2.0 packages fixes these regressions.
